U.S. Moves to Tighten Foreign Student Visa Policies Amid Concerns
TL;DR Summary
The Trump administration's decision to pause all visa interviews for foreign students seeking to study in the US, pending a review of social media vetting, is seen as a harmful move that threatens America's reputation as a leader in higher education, despite potential policy adjustments.
